Centos7學習之添加用戶和用戶組的方法
在使用 Centos 之前用的更多是Ubuntu,所以在 useradd 和 adduser 兩條命令出現(xiàn)歧義,在Ubuntu系統(tǒng)上這是兩條命令,而在Centos上則是同一條命令,adduser 是鏈接的形式存在
# ll /usr/sbin/ | grep user lrwxrwxrwx. 1 root root 7 10月 30 17:09 adduser -> useradd -rwxr-x---. 1 root root 114064 6月 10 09:16 useradd
1、添加用戶,Centos 沒有任何交互動作!創(chuàng)建用戶完畢后,必須修改密碼否則無法登陸
# useradd dev #創(chuàng)建用戶 # passwd dev #修改密碼 更改用戶 dev 的密碼 。 新的 密碼: 重新輸入新的 密碼: passwd:所有的身份驗證令牌已經(jīng)成功更新。
2、為新建用戶添加 sudo 權(quán)限,否則啥事都要請教 root 老大不合適,你懂得!
1)sudoers 文件添加可寫權(quán)限
# chmod -v u+w /etc/sudoers "/etc/sudoers" 的權(quán)限模式保留為0640 (rw-r-----)
2)在 sudoers 文件添加新用戶信息到 ## Allow root to run any commands anywher 下,修改后的效果為
## Allow root to run any commands anywher root ALL=(ALL) ALL dev ALL=(ALL) ALL #新增用戶信息
3)取消 sudoers 文件可寫權(quán)限
# chmod -v u-w /etc/sudoers mode of "/etc/sudoers" changed from 0640 (rw-r-----) to 0440 (r--r-----)
建工作組
groupadd test //新建test工作組
新建用戶同時增加工作組
useradd -g test phpq //新建phpq用戶并增加到test工作組
注::-g 所屬組 -d 家目錄 -s 所用的SHELL
給已有的用戶增加工作組
usermod -G groupname username 或者:gpasswd -a user group
補充:查看用戶和用戶組的方法
用戶列表文件:/etc/passwd
用戶組列表文件:/etc/group
查看系統(tǒng)中有哪些用戶:cut -d : -f 1 /etc/passwd
查看可以登錄系統(tǒng)的用戶:cat /etc/passwd | grep -v /sbin/nologin | cut -d : -f 1
查看某一用戶:w 用戶名
查看登錄用戶:who
查看用戶登錄歷史記錄:last
以上就是本文的全部內(nèi)容,希望對大家的學習有所幫助,也希望大家多多支持本站。
版權(quán)聲明:本站文章來源標注為YINGSOO的內(nèi)容版權(quán)均為本站所有,歡迎引用、轉(zhuǎn)載,請保持原文完整并注明來源及原文鏈接。禁止復(fù)制或仿造本網(wǎng)站,禁止在非www.sddonglingsh.com所屬的服務(wù)器上建立鏡像,否則將依法追究法律責任。本站部分內(nèi)容來源于網(wǎng)友推薦、互聯(lián)網(wǎng)收集整理而來,僅供學習參考,不代表本站立場,如有內(nèi)容涉嫌侵權(quán),請聯(lián)系alex-e#qq.com處理。